NY prosecutor’s office to investigate the death of a man at the hands of the police on the Belt Parkway – Telemundo New York (47)

The New York Attorney General’s Office of Special Investigation has opened an investigation into the death of Brian Astarita, who died on November 11 at the hands of New York City Police officers in Brooklyn, the Attorney General’s Office announced on Sunday.

According to the prosecutor’s report, Brian Astarita, 65, a Brooklyn resident, hit a police vehicle that had stopped him for speeding on the highway Belt Parkway and kept driving.

Backup units caught up with him near the Bay Parkway exit. At that time, the Police pointed out that Astarita stopped her vehicle, near Cropsey Avenue Gravesend, and came out with a gun.

New York City Police Chief Rodney Harrison said he “approached an officer with the gun” and ignored warnings to stop. At that time, the report said, officers fired

The man was taken to hospital with a gunshot wound to his leg and later died, police sources said. The incident led to the closure of the highway and caused delays in both directions.

Police said a gun was recovered at the scene. A witness, who was in Astarita’s Jeep at the time, captured the deadly confrontation between him and police on cell phone video. More than a dozen shots were heard.

Astarita had a half-dozen previous arrests, cops said Friday.

His most recent arrest was for the aggravated unlicensed operation of a vehicle, police officers confirmed to our sister network NBC. It was unclear exactly when that happened, nor the details about his other arrests.
